Protocol summary

Study aim
Effect of distraction force as parallel to radius shaft or perpendicular to distal radius joint line on radiographic reduction of distal radius fracture and clinical results
Design
Two arm intervention parallel group, not blinded, randomized trial with sealed envelops randomization and 6-week follow-up for postoperative radiologic and clinical results
Settings and conduct
This trial would be done in Shahid Kamyab and Imam Reza Hospitals of Mashhad University of Medical Sciences. Patients are included after informed consent obtained and they allocate to either of intervention groups according to sealed envelops randomization method. Clinical indices include wrist function and pain and radiologic indices were assessed in follow-up, 6 weeks after the operation.
Participants/Inclusion and exclusion criteria
patients in 18 to 60 years with unilateral acute distal radius fracture with more than 5 millimeters shortening without previous fracture, open fracture or inflammatory disease
Intervention groups
First intervention group: applying distraction force as parallel to radius shaft using pre-fabricated Avisa external fixator Second intervention group: applying distraction force as perpendicular to distal radius joint line using pre-fabricated Avisa external fixator
Main outcome variables
Radiologic indices; Clinical indices include wrist function and pain

Intervention groups

1

Description
Intervention group 1: In sterile condition of operating room under general anesthesia and prep and drape, first closed reduction with appropriate maneuver is done. Then 2 two millimeters schanz pins in second metacarpus and 2 two millimeters schanz pins in radius shaft is inserted in lateral side. Then Avisa Co. wrist external fixator is attached to these schanz pins. We put radial inclination and palmar tilt indices to zero value and distraction force is applied in parallel to radius shaft. All procedures were checked by fluoroscopy.
Category
Treatment - Surgery

2

Description
Intervention group 2: In sterile condition of operating room under general anesthesia and prep and drape, first closed reduction with appropriate maneuver is done. Then 2 two millimeters schanz pins in second metacarpus and 2 two millimeters schanz pins in radius shaft is inserted in lateral side. Then Avisa Co. wrist external fixator is attached to these schanz pins. We put radial inclination and palmar tilt indices as the other side values and distraction force is applied perpendicular to distal radius joint line. All procedures were checked by fluoroscopy.
